European Knowledge and Technology Transfer Practice Survey

This survey is administered by the University of Applied Sciences Northwestern Switzerland (Fachhochschule Nordwestschweiz FHNW) on behalf of the European Commission, DG Research & Innovation. It aims to obtain primary internationally comparable data on principles and practices of intellectual property (IP) management and transfer to the private sector for universities and public research institutes in Europe. It assesses these principles and practices along the lines of the European Commission's Recommendation on Knowledge Transfer (see http://ec.europa.eu/invest-in-research/pdf/download_en/ip_recommendation.pdf) and the Code of Practice for universities and other public research organisations in annex I. It serves to increase knowledge of IP management and knowledge transfer and provides input for improved policy-making and funding in Europe.

The online questionnaire for the survey consists of 43 questions addressing principles and practices in the modules IP policy, services and incentives in IP and knowledge transfer, exploitation and commercialisation practice, collaborative and contract research, monitoring and communication of research, IP and knowledge transfer, and staff of the transfer offices.

The survey covers the 27 EU member states and the 12 countries associated to the 7th European Framework Programme. It is sent to 100 selected leading universities and public research institutions in either their country or in Europe in 2011. Respondents are the responsible offices for knowledge and technology transfer and/or research.

The survey is piloted in 2011. It will be followed by a full survey to a larger sample in 2012.
